Abstract
The utility model relates to an irregularly-shaped chocolate sleeve case embossing machine, which comprises a machine frame, a work platform, a paper conveying mechanism, a waste paper recycling mechanism and a material feeding mechanism, wherein the work platform is arranged on the machine frame, the paper conveying mechanism is fixed on one end of the work platform, and the other end of the work platform is connected with the waste paper recycling mechanism. The utility model has the innovation points that a paper cutting sleeve case mechanism is connected on the work platform, both sides of the paper cutting sleeve case mechanism are provided with embossing mechanisms, and sugar separating plates are connected between the embossing mechanisms and the paper cutting sleeve case mechanisms and are arranged on the work platform through a rotating shaft. The utility model has the advatages that after the operation of the paper cutting sleeve case through the paper cutting sleeve case mechanism, the chocolate is transmitted into the embossing mechanisms through the sugar separating plates for surface embossing, and the production effect and the atomization degree are improved.
Description
Technical field
The utility model relates to the chocolate sheath body embossing press of a kind of abnormity, comprise frame, workplatform, paper feed mechanism, waste paper recovering mechanism, pay-off, described frame is provided with workplatform, one end of described workplatform is fixed with paper feed mechanism, and the other end is connected with the waste paper recovering mechanism.
Background technology
Traditional chocolate need carry out chocolate sheath body and embossing operation respectively, complex steps, inefficiency on sheath body machine and embossing press in producing.
The utility model content
The technical problems to be solved in the utility model provides the chocolate sheath body embossing press of a kind of abnormity, collection sheath body and embossing and one, and the degree of automation height significantly improves production efficiency.
For solving the problems of the technologies described above, the technical solution of the utility model is: the chocolate sheath body embossing press of a kind of abnormity, comprise frame, workplatform, paper feed mechanism, the waste paper recovering mechanism, pay-off, described frame is provided with workplatform, one end of described workplatform is fixed with paper feed mechanism, the other end is connected with the waste paper recovering mechanism, its innovative point is: be connected with cut paper sheath body mechanism on the described workplatform, the both sides of described cut paper sheath body mechanism are provided with embossing mechanism, be connected with the sugared plate of branch between described embossing mechanism and cut paper sheath body mechanism, the sugared plate of described branch is installed on the workplatform by rotating shaft.
Further, the structure of described cut paper sheath body mechanism is: cover for seat is fixed on the workplatform, upper and lower cut paper mechanism is housed on the described cover for seat, described upper and lower cut paper mechanism is by crescent moon pillar captive joint, the center of described upper and lower cut paper mechanism has cavity, is connected with upper and lower drift in the described cavity.
Further, described embossing mechanism is by having cavity on the embossing platen, and connects upper and lower forcer constitute in cavity.
Further, the sugared plate of described branch is fan-shaped, has the sugared hole of branch and push away sugared groove on the sugared plate of described branch.
Advantage of the present utility model is: chocolate carry out the cut paper sheath body by cut paper sheath body mechanism after, pass by a minute sugared plate and to carry out embossed surface in the embossing mechanism, improved production efficiency and degree of automation.

The specific embodiment
As shown in Figure 1, 2, 3, comprise frame 1, workplatform 2, paper feed mechanism 3, waste paper recovering mechanism 4, cut paper sheath body mechanism 5, cover for seat 6, go up cut paper mechanism 7, incision mechanism of paper 8, upward go up cut paper tool rest 9, up and down cut paper tool rest 10, upward go up cut paper blade 11, up and down cut paper blade 12, down go up cut paper tool rest 13, following cut paper tool rest 14, go up cut paper blade 15, following cut paper blade 16, vertically push rod 17, crescent moon pillar 18, pay-off 19, upper punch 21, low punch 22, embossing mechanism 23, the sugared plate 27 of branch, rotating shaft 20 down.
Above-mentioned frame 1 is provided with workplatform 2, and workplatform 2 one ends are equipped with paper feed mechanism 3, and the other end is connected with waste paper recovering mechanism 4, is connected with cut paper sheath body mechanism 5 on the workplatform 2.
As shown in Figure 3, the concrete structure of described cut paper sheath body mechanism 5 is: cover for seat 6 is fixed on the workplatform 2, and upper and lower cut paper mechanism 7,8 is housed on the cover for seat.
Described go up cut paper mechanism 7 by last cut paper tool rest 9 and up and down cut paper tool rest 10 constitute, be fixed with cut paper blade 11, cut paper blade 12 about cut paper tool rest 10 is provided with up and down on the cut paper tool rest 9 on described; Described incision mechanism of paper 8 constitutes by going up cut paper tool rest 13 and following cut paper tool rest 14 down, and described going up on the cut paper tool rest 13 down is fixed with down cut paper blade 15, and following cut paper tool rest 14 is provided with down cut paper blade 16 down.Wherein, cut paper blade 12, following cut paper blade 16 are all captiveed joint with vertical push rod 17 up and down.Up and down cut paper tool rest 10 with go up down cut paper tool rest 13 and captive joint by crescent moon pillar 18, form semi-enclosed cavity, be connected with pay-off 19 in a side of this cavity, can be referring to Fig. 2.The center of described cut paper sheath body mechanism 5 has cavity, is connected with upper and lower drift 21,22 in the described cavity.
During this cut paper sheath body mechanism 5 work: the candy paper of paper feed mechanism 3 divides upper and lower two-layer entering in the upper and lower cut paper mechanism 7,8, the upper strata candy paper is at last cut paper blade 11 and up and down between the cut paper blade 12, and lower floor's candy paper is on down between cut paper blade 15 and the following cut paper blade 16.In the semiclosed chamber about pay-off 19 pushes chocolate between cut paper tool rest 10 and time last cut paper tool rest 13, vertical push rod 17 is jack-up cut paper blade 12 and following cut paper blade 16 up and down upwards, upper and lower two-layer candy paper is cut into chocolate last lower casing, simultaneously, upper and lower drift 21,22 is to middle punching press, to go up lower casing and be pressed on the chocolate, finish sheath body operation chocolate.
Both sides in cut paper sheath body mechanism 5 are equipped with embossing mechanism 23, and referring to Fig. 2, described embossing mechanism 23 is by having cavity on the embossing platen 24, and connect upper and lower forcer 25,26 constitute in cavity.Be connected with the sugared plate 27 of branch between described embossing mechanism 23 and the cut paper sheath body mechanism 5, the sugared plate 27 of described branch is fan-shaped, have in the sugared plate of described branch both sides the sugared hole 28,28 of branch of symmetry ' and push away sugared groove 29,29 ', wherein, push away sugared groove 29,29 ' the be positioned at sugared hole 28,28 of branch ' both sides.This divides sugared plate 27 to be installed on the workplatform 2 by rotating shaft 20, and drops on the upper surface of cut paper sheath body mechanism 5.
Behind the sheath body that cut paper sheath body mechanism 5 finishes chocolate, on, low punch 21,22 rise, in the sugared hole 28 of branch of the sugared plate 27 of branch above low punch 22 pushes chocolate, divide sugar version 27 on the embossing platen 24 that goes to the left side under the effect of rotating shaft 20, in the embossing mechanism 23, following forcer 25,26 pairs of chocolates carry out embossing, the sugared hole 28 of branch that low punch 22 continuation simultaneously push another side with second chocolate ' in, divide sugared plate 27 travelling backwards, and the chocolate that new sheath body is good divides in the embossing mechanism 23 of another side, at this moment, the 3rd chocolate enters the sugared hole 28 of branch, divides sugared plate 27 to move to the left, simultaneously again, the embossing mechanism 23 in left side finishes the embossing operation to chocolate, following forcer 26 divides its back pressure flower platen 24 upper surfaces the sugared groove 29 of pushing away of sugared plate 27 contact with chocolate earlier, and it is released embossing mechanism 23.Like this, the mobile repeatedly back and forth linking that realizes chocolate sheath body and embossing by minute sugared plate 27 makes the sheath body embossing once finish, and has improved production efficiency and degree of automation.
